Overview

Snail family zinc finger 1 pseudogene 1 (SNAI1P1), also known as SNAI1L, is a processed pseudogene on human chromosome 2q34 that shares sequence similarity with the SNAI1 gene encoding a zinc finger transcriptional repressor[4][6]. Unlike SNAI1, SNAI1P1 does not code for a functional protein but has regulatory roles at the RNA level. Recent research indicates SNAI1P1 may function as a competitive endogenous RNA, decoying microRNA-153, and thus preventing miR-153 from repressing SNAI1 mRNA. This molecular interaction results in elevated SNAI1 protein expression, indirectly promoting EMT and increasing the invasive potential of cancer cells, notably in endometrial cancer[2]. It is not a direct therapeutic target and does not encode a receptor, enzyme, transporter, or conventional drug target, but research suggests it could serve as a prognostic biomarker in oncology[2][6].

Mechanism of action

Acts as a microRNA decoy (competes for miR-153, thereby regulating SNAI1 translation)

Disease associations

Cancer (notably endometrial cancer progression through EMT regulation)
